提升LAMP架构下MySQL性能可从以下方面入手:
索引优化
SQL语句优化
SELECT *,仅查询必要字段,减少数据传输。JOIN替代子查询,优化多表关联查询。LIMIT限制分页数据量,避免大偏移量查询。EXPLAIN分析查询计划,定位慢查询瓶颈。配置参数优化
innodb_buffer_pool_size为物理内存的70%-80%,提升缓存效率。max_connections和thread_cache_size。架构层面优化
硬件与系统优化
net.ipv4.tcp_tw_reuse)支持更多并发连接。定期维护
OPTIMIZE TABLE整理表碎片,更新统计信息。参考来源:[1,2,3,4,5,6,7,8,9,10,11]